The sedan Mazda 626 1987 - 1992 year modification 2.0 AT (140 hp)

Engine

Engine type petrol
Engine location front, transverse
Engine capacity, cm³ 1995
Boost type No
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 140 / 103 at 6500
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 186 at 4000
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 4
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system distributed injection
Compression ratio 9.7
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 84 × 90

General information

Brand country Japan
Car class D
Number of doors 4

Performance indicators

Fuel type Super (95)

Sizes in mm

Length 4534
Width 1689
Height 1410
Wheelbase 2576
Ground clearance 155
Front track width 1461
Rear track width 1461
Wheel size 185 / 70 / R14

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disc
Rear brakes drum

Transmission

Transmission automatic
Number of gears 4
Drive type front

Volume and weight

Fuel tank capacity, l 60
Trunk volume min/max, l 467

Performance and Engine Specifications

Under the hood, the Mazda 626 boasts a 2.0-liter inline-4 petrol engine, delivering 140 horsepower at 6500 rpm and 186 Nm of torque at 4000 rpm. The engine features a distributed injection system and a compression ratio of 9.7, ensuring smooth and efficient performance. With a 4-speed automatic transmission and front-wheel drive, this car offers a balanced driving experience, whether you're navigating city streets or cruising on the highway. The fuel type is Super (95), making it a cost-effective option for long-distance travel.

Design and Dimensions

The Mazda 626’s sedan body type is both elegant and functional. Measuring 4534 mm in length, 1689 mm in width, and 1410 mm in height, it provides ample space for passengers and cargo. The wheelbase of 2576 mm ensures stability, while the ground clearance of 155 mm makes it suitable for various road conditions. The car’s 185/70/R14 wheels and independent spring suspension system contribute to a comfortable and controlled ride. The trunk offers a generous 467 liters of storage, making it ideal for family trips or daily errands.
